4 CD archive release of music from the Jerry Garcia Acoustic Band and Jerry Garcia Band matinee and evening shows at Lunt-Fontanne Theater, New York City on October 31, 1987. Comprises complete acoustic and electric sets from each performance.

The soundboard tapes from which this CD package originated were created under far less than ideal, and in certain senses downright intimidating, circumstances. Aside from their main purpose - presenting a gloriously abundant slice of the Jerry Garcia Band's legendary 13 Magical Nights On Broadway - the recordings contained herein also clearly prove the worth of courage, hard work and modern science. Rest assured, as you enjoy this music, it hasn't sounded nearly this good since performed live.
